To enter the **Remove** keyword in the command line, use one of the options:

- Press Delete Delete
- Type **Remove** 
- Type the shortcut **Remov**

## Description

The Remove keyword enters remove values in the programmer depending on the attributes specified and the fixtures that were selected.

Remove values that are stored using the merge function remove previously stored values.

If a stored value is removed, values from the previous cue will be tracked again.

## Syntax

**Remove Object \["Object\_Name" or Object\_Number]**

## Examples

- To set all attributes of the current selection to Remove, type:

|                                                                    |                             |
| ------------------------------------------------------------------ | --------------------------- |
| ![](/img/grandma3/2-4/icon_commandline-input_logo_v2-0-a59235.png) | User name\[Fixture]>Remove  |

 

- To set the Remove value in all attributes of the feature group Position, however in only the selected layer, type:

|                                                                    |                                                     |
| ------------------------------------------------------------------ | --------------------------------------------------- |
| ![](/img/grandma3/2-4/icon_commandline-input_logo_v2-0-a59235.png) | User name\[Fixture]>Remove FeatureGroup "Position"  |
